Tampa Bay Downs, Race 7, 3:49 pm ET

Allowance/Optional Claiming, 1 1/16 miles, Turf, Fillies & Mares 3 & Up

Nine go in this allowance in Tampa. We like a 3-year-old filly who drew the rail, 1-Be Up, who seems to be on the improve, as she comes off a win in an allowance race at Colonial Downs on September 1. She has been away since, but seems primed for a top effort here for trainer Jonathan Thomas, and we think the post will help, as being inside will help her save ground around the turns. Look for her to sit just behind the first flight of horses early, and to win with a move as the field turns for home. We think Be Up will get up, and will bet her to win at 3-1. The bet: Tampa Bay Downs, Race 7, $35 to win on 1-Be Up.

Churchill Downs, Race 7, 4:06 pm ET

Allowance/Optional Claiming, 1 ⅛ miles, Dirt, Fillies & Mares 3 & Up

Fillies and mares 3 and older, seven of them, go in this second-level allowance at Churchill Downs. The pick is 1-Bold Tactics, a 3-year-old Union Rags filly who spent the late summer and fall running on the Pennsylvania/New Jersey circuit for trainer Kelly Breen, but who here makes her first start for Brad Cox. We like the way she ran in her last start, when she won an allowance race at Monmouth Park, but we like even more the fact that Cox wins at a 26% clip with horses making their first start in his barn. We will bet Bold Tactics to win at 3-1. The bet: Churchill Downs, Race 7, $40 to win on 1-Bold Tactics.

Churchill Downs, Race 8, 4:36 pm ET

Allowance, 1 ¼ miles, Dirt, 3 & Up

A field of nine lines up here. We like 4-Bourbon Thunder, who drops back to allowance company after running fairly well in a couple of stakes: he was a close fourth in the West Virginia Derby in August, and second in the Bourbon Trial at Churchill on Sept. 25. He has posted a couple of good workouts since, and has both the pedigree (by Quality Road, out of a Stormy Atlantic mare) and the running style to handle the mile and a quarter distance. We will bet him to win at 5/2. The bet: Churchill Downs, Race 8, $40 to win on 4-Bourbon Thunder.
